REID, David Elwood

REID, David Elwood - 63, Dartmouth, passed away peacefully at home November 1, 2005, after a courageous
battle with cancer. Born in Sunnyside, NL, he was the oldest son of the late Grace (Sheppard) and Levi Reid. He is
survived by his loving wife, Lisa (Smith) and their daughter, Grace; his children, Kenneth, Victoria Madsen and
Michael; grandchildren, Reid, Bethany and Caris Madsen; sisters, Barbara (Don Smith), Linda April; brother, Rex.
David was a member of the Royal Canadian Navy before entering into the labour relations industry. He was a
labour relations negotiator for over 25 years. David was a member of the Nova Scotia Labour Board. He was
well-respected by his peers and colleagues. David was an avid boater for many years, boating was his true
passion. He also enjoyed motorcycling, scuba diving and RVing. David was a proud member of the Christian
Motorcycle Association. He lived a very full and active life, always living in the moment. Arrangements are entrusted
